Abstract
We show that if then any non-trivial -closed forcing notion of size is forcing equivalent to the Cohen forcing for adding a new Cohen subset of We also produce, relative to the existence of suitable large cardinals, a model of in which and all -closed forcing notion of size collapse and hence are forcing equivalent to These results answer a question of Scott Williams from 1978. We also extend a result of Todorcevic and Foreman-Magidor-Shelah by showing that it is consistent that every partial order which adds a new subset of collapses or
